About Rajamunda Village

Rajamunda is a mid sized village in Chhindgarh tehsil, in the district of Dakshin Bastar Dantewada, Chhattisgarh. The Census of India 2011 recorded a population of 742, made up of 377 males and 365 females. That works out to a sex ratio of about 968 females per 1000 males. The village covers 489 hectares hectares. Its pincode is 494111, shared with the other villages in the same post office area.

Getting to Rajamunda

The census records public bus service for Rajamunda as Available. Private bus service is recorded as Available within 5 - 10 km distance. For rail, the census notes the nearest railway station as Available within 10+ km distance. These entries describe what was recorded in 2011 and services may have changed since.
